My Baby Unicorn 2 invites children into a magical world where they care for their own baby unicorn. This simulation game teaches responsibility and kindness through interactive tasks. Players start each day by waking the unicorn and choosing its favorite breakfast from the fridge, such as bread, apples, or soda. After eating, help the unicorn with bathroom needs. Then play together with toys like a ball or puzzle. When the unicorn gets tired, give it a soothing bath and tuck it into bed. The game also includes a wardrobe with dresses, hats, and accessories for dress-up fun. Designed for young children, it combines caring tasks with creative dress-up in a safe environment.
To play, wake the baby unicorn by tapping. Open the fridge and drag a food item to the unicorn. After feeding, guide it to the toilet by tapping. Choose a toy or activity, like a ball, and tap to play. When the unicorn is tired, tap the bathtub and soap to prepare a warm bath, then dry it. Finally, select a cozy blanket to put the unicorn to bed. The closet lets you pick outfits by tapping and dragging. Simple controls make it easy for kids to navigate each step of the daily routine.
